Murphy started today in his fitness training...
20 mins down the lane in walk and lots of transitions from walk to trot - trot to walk. Went very well I think.
Tomorrow I'm planning to do some lunging work. Again lots of transitions to get him working from behind. Then Im going to alternate between riding and lunging then for the next few weeks, get him working well before I even think of jumping etc.
My question is, in a few weeks once he's getting fitter i would like to use draw reins on him while lunging, I know they need to be nice and loose - but how should I fit them - to the d rings? and if they are too long can I just tie a loop by the cantle to stop them drooping down? I'm not even sure if you can use them on the lunge, but that is what I was planning to do...
